Artificial Intelligence-Supported Education, Student Anxiety, and Academic Engagement: Examining the Moderating Role of Coping Self-Efficacy

Abstract

Artificial Intelligence (AI)-supported education is increasingly transforming higher education by providing personalized learning, immediate academic assistance, and flexible access to educational resources; however, its psychological implications for students remain an important area of investigation. The present study examined the relationships among Artificial Intelligence-Supported Education, Student Anxiety, Academic Engagement, and Coping Self-Efficacy, with particular emphasis on the moderating role of coping self-efficacy in the relationship between anxiety and academic engagement. A quantitative, cross-sectional research design was employed, and data were collected from 268 university students from higher education institutions in Punjab and Sindh, Pakistan. Data were collected through an adopted structured questionnaire using online Google Forms, and the completed responses were organized in Microsoft Excel and analyzed using IBM SPSS. Descriptive statistics, Cronbach’s alpha reliability analysis, Pearson correlation, multiple linear regression, independent-samples t-test, one-way ANOVA, post-hoc analysis, and moderation analysis were employed. The findings indicated significant relationships among the major study variables, with AI-supported education being positively associated with academic engagement and negatively associated with student anxiety. Student anxiety was negatively associated with academic engagement, whereas coping self-efficacy demonstrated a positive association with academic engagement. The regression findings further indicated that AI-supported education, student anxiety, and coping self-efficacy were significant predictors of academic engagement. The moderation findings demonstrated that coping self-efficacy significantly weakened the negative relationship between student anxiety and academic engagement, highlighting its potential protective role in students’ academic experiences. The study contributes to the emerging literature on AI-supported higher education by demonstrating that the effectiveness of AI-based learning should be considered alongside students’ psychological well-being and coping resources. The findings have practical implications for universities, educators, and policymakers in developing AI-supported learning environments that promote academic engagement while addressing student anxiety and strengthening coping capabilities.
